Jangansan County Park
Situated in Jangsu-gun in Jeollabuk-do, Jangansan Mountain (alt. 1,237 m) was officially designated a county park in 1986. Deoksan Valley Stream, which originates in the southwestern part of Jangansan Mountain and flows into Yongnimcheon Stream, is famous for the Deoksanyongso Waterfall Basins and the 20 or so large rocks that dot its banks. The sprawling fields of reeds along the East Ridge are also a major draw, undulating like waves of gold in the crisp autumn wind. In particular, the east hiking path on Jangansan Mountain is lined with a wide field of silver grass making it popular among hikers. Official location: Jangan-ri, Jangsu-gun, Jeonbuk-do. How to enjoy
Hiking course: Course 1: Muryonggogae Pass → Jangansan Mountain (3.2 km, 1 hr 30 min) Course 2: Milmokjae Pass → Jangansan Mountain (9 km, 4 hr 30 min) Course 3: Jisogol Valley → Jangansan Mountain (3 km, 1 hr 30 min) Course 4: Goeomokdong → Jangansan Mountain (5 km, 2 hr 30 min) Course 5: Yeonju → Jangansan Mountain (5.7 km, 2 hr 30 min) Course 6: Beomyeondong → Jangansan Mountain (5.5 km, 2 hr 30 min) Areas open to visitors: Muryeonggogae Pass – Jangansan Mountain (2.5 km) These highlights come from the Korea Tourism Organization and can change — confirm facilities, courses, and access on the official channel before you visit.
